    The Japanese style of negotiation.

    Japanese people are characterized by prudence, manners, politeness, and a strong tendency towards groups.

    The desire for survival and development of the body. The typical character of the Japanese is considered to be a typical "hard shell".

    Mental structure. The Japanese showed great patience in the negotiations and strongly hoped that the negotiations would be successful.

    Merit. Japanese businessmen have a strong sense of time and a fast pace of life, which is filled by the life of the Japanese.

    Caused by competition. In Japanese society, there is a special emphasis on order and human relationships. Japanese business.

    People like to get to know each other and gain a sense of understanding before a formal negotiation is made.

    Affection, promote transactions, and this contact is often introduced through friends or appropriate people. Japanese.

    It is often not possible to be frank and clear in negotiations. Sometimes the moisture in ** is very large, often made.

    The negotiation opponent has an ambiguous, ambiguous impression or even misunderstanding, which makes the negotiation opponent ambiguous.

    Feeling restless.

    Japanese people are generally extremely cautious before signing a contract, and are accustomed to scrutinizing the contract in detail.

    And do a good job of coordination internally, which requires a long process. But once the decision is made.

    In particular, Japanese businessmen can attach importance to the performance of contracts, and the performance rate is very high. Therefore, with Japanese businessmen.

    Negotiate patiently, be introduced beforehand, carefully review the contract before it is signed, and make ambiguities clear so as not to cause disputes later.

    A Question Analysis: The Nation of Japan.

    The composition is single, the Yamato nation has an absolute advantage, and its traditional costume is the kimono, and the Japanese culture has a strong tolerance.

    The traditional color of the Yamato nation is thick, influenced by Chinese culture in ancient times, and the traditional oriental culture is strong; In modern times, it has been widely influenced by European and American science and technology, literature and art, etc., and is a typical example of the compatibility of Eastern and Western cultures.
